Temperature Considerations



When it comes to business exterior painting, temperature plays a critical role in the end result of your task. If you're painting in extreme heat, the paint can dry as well swiftly, resulting in concerns like inadequate bond and unequal surfaces. You intend to aim for temperatures between 50 ° F and 85 ° F for the very best results. Below 50 ° F, paint might not heal appropriately, while over 85 ° F, you take the chance of blistering and cracking.

Timing your project with the ideal temperature levels is crucial. Start your job early in the morning or later on in the mid-day when it's cooler, specifically throughout hot months.

Moisture Levels



Humidity degrees considerably influence the success of your commercial external painting job. When the humidity is too high, it can prevent paint drying and curing, bring about a variety of issues like bad adhesion and finish high quality.

If you're planning a work throughout damp conditions, you might discover that the paint takes longer to completely dry, which can expand your project timeline and rise expenses.

Conversely, low humidity can likewise present obstacles. Paint may dry out too rapidly, protecting against proper application and causing an uneven finish.

You'll intend to monitor the humidity degrees closely to ensure you're working within the optimal array, typically between 40% and 70%.

To get the very best results, take into consideration utilizing a hygrometer to gauge moisture before beginning your job.

If you locate the levels are outside the optimal variety, you might require to readjust your schedule or select paints created for variable conditions.

Constantly seek advice from the maker's guidelines for particular suggestions on humidity tolerance.

Rainfall Influence



Rain or snow can significantly interrupt your industrial outside paint plans. When rainfall takes place, it can remove freshly used paint or create an unequal surface. Preferably, you intend to choose days with completely dry climate to make sure the paint sticks correctly and treatments successfully. If you're captured in a shower, it's finest to halt the job and wait on conditions to enhance.

Moreover, snow can be much more destructive. Not only does it create a damp surface area, but it can likewise reduce temperature levels, making it hard for paint to completely dry. This can result in problems like peeling or blistering down the line.

It's vital to check the weather report prior to beginning your job. If rain or snow is forecasted, take into consideration rescheduling.



Constantly keep in mind to allow sufficient drying out time between coats, specifically if the weather stays unforeseeable.
